Trial/Ordeal - a situation of difficulty for a person, something they are forced to endure over a period of time, Obstacle/hurdle - something which prevents progress or success, Undertaking/mission - a serious responsibility or large task which a person agrees to take on, Exploit/adventure - a brave and daring action, Accomplishment/Feat - an achievement, something which requires a lot of effort and ability, Dodge - to avoid something unpleasant or dangerous by moving out of the way, Contend with/cope - to have to deal with problems or difficulties, often in order to achieve something, Claim - to say officially that you think something belongs to you, Extend hospitality - to invite someone to your home, to provide food and drinks, A case in point - a particular example of the situation or behaviour being discussed, Discount/dismiss/ignore - not consider something at all, as you believe it is not important or worth paying attention to, Showcase - to exhibit something in a way to show its best qualities, Household name - something or someone that is very well-known, Momentous/Crucial/Vital - extremely important, changing the course of events,
